Les Gymnopédies or Trois Gymnopédies are a series of three variations on Impressionist slow waltzes for solo piano, composed by Erik Satie and published in Paris in 1888. They were inspired by Gustave Flaubert's historical novel Salammbô (1862) and the Gymnopédies, ritual dances performed in Sparta during religious festivals in ancient Greece. Along with the Gnossiennes, they are among his most famous compositions.
